Retama Lake Dam, located in Webb County, Texas, was completed in 1965 with a primary purpose of serving as a water supply source.

This earth dam stands at a height of 25 feet and stretches 2300 feet in length, creating a reservoir with a normal storage capacity of 244 acre-feet and a maximum storage capacity of 400 acre-feet. The dam is situated on Tordillo Creek and is owned by a private entity.
Despite being categorized as having a high risk potential and lacking a hazard assessment rating, Retama Lake Dam has not been inspected or rated for its current condition. With no spillway and limited structural information available, it's vital that the dam undergoes regular inspections and maintenance to ensure its continued safety and functionality.
